Package io.fabric8.kubernetes.api.model
Interface HandlerFluent<A extends HandlerFluent<A>>
-
- All Superinterfaces:
Fluent<A>
- All Known Subinterfaces:
LifecycleFluent.PostStartNested<N>
,LifecycleFluent.PreStopNested<N>
,WatchEventFluent.HandlerObjectNested<N>
- All Known Implementing Classes:
HandlerBuilder
,HandlerFluentImpl
,LifecycleFluentImpl.PostStartNestedImpl
,LifecycleFluentImpl.PreStopNestedImpl
,WatchEventFluentImpl.HandlerObjectNestedImpl
public interface HandlerFluent<A extends HandlerFluent<A>> extends Fluent<A>
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static interface
HandlerFluent.ExecNested<N>
static interface
HandlerFluent.HttpGetNested<N>
static interface
HandlerFluent.TcpSocketNested<N>
-
Method Summary
-
-
-
Method Detail
-
getExec
@Deprecated ExecAction getExec()
Deprecated.This method has been deprecated, please use method buildExec instead.- Returns:
- The buildable object.
-
buildExec
ExecAction buildExec()
-
withExec
A withExec(ExecAction exec)
-
hasExec
Boolean hasExec()
-
withNewExec
HandlerFluent.ExecNested<A> withNewExec()
-
withNewExecLike
HandlerFluent.ExecNested<A> withNewExecLike(ExecAction item)
-
editExec
HandlerFluent.ExecNested<A> editExec()
-
editOrNewExec
HandlerFluent.ExecNested<A> editOrNewExec()
-
editOrNewExecLike
HandlerFluent.ExecNested<A> editOrNewExecLike(ExecAction item)
-
getHttpGet
@Deprecated HTTPGetAction getHttpGet()
Deprecated.This method has been deprecated, please use method buildHttpGet instead.- Returns:
- The buildable object.
-
buildHttpGet
HTTPGetAction buildHttpGet()
-
withHttpGet
A withHttpGet(HTTPGetAction httpGet)
-
hasHttpGet
Boolean hasHttpGet()
-
withNewHttpGet
HandlerFluent.HttpGetNested<A> withNewHttpGet()
-
withNewHttpGetLike
HandlerFluent.HttpGetNested<A> withNewHttpGetLike(HTTPGetAction item)
-
editHttpGet
HandlerFluent.HttpGetNested<A> editHttpGet()
-
editOrNewHttpGet
HandlerFluent.HttpGetNested<A> editOrNewHttpGet()
-
editOrNewHttpGetLike
HandlerFluent.HttpGetNested<A> editOrNewHttpGetLike(HTTPGetAction item)
-
getTcpSocket
@Deprecated TCPSocketAction getTcpSocket()
Deprecated.This method has been deprecated, please use method buildTcpSocket instead.- Returns:
- The buildable object.
-
buildTcpSocket
TCPSocketAction buildTcpSocket()
-
withTcpSocket
A withTcpSocket(TCPSocketAction tcpSocket)
-
hasTcpSocket
Boolean hasTcpSocket()
-
withNewTcpSocket
HandlerFluent.TcpSocketNested<A> withNewTcpSocket()
-
withNewTcpSocketLike
HandlerFluent.TcpSocketNested<A> withNewTcpSocketLike(TCPSocketAction item)
-
editTcpSocket
HandlerFluent.TcpSocketNested<A> editTcpSocket()
-
editOrNewTcpSocket
HandlerFluent.TcpSocketNested<A> editOrNewTcpSocket()
-
editOrNewTcpSocketLike
HandlerFluent.TcpSocketNested<A> editOrNewTcpSocketLike(TCPSocketAction item)
-
-